Very finicky, unreliable --> (Updated / Changed; everything is now good)
UPDATED REVIEW (March 29, 2020): After discussions with the manufacturer, and performing additional tests, it was determined that I had received an older version of the cables. They sent me the newer version at no cost. After testing with the new cables, which included a lot of cable movement / adjustments while the RAID arrays were built and running, there were no dropped drives or reliability issues at all. Everything worked perfectly. I'll also add that it was a real pleasure working with the supplier, as they were very professional and friendly throughout the process. As such, I've changed my review from 2 stars up to 5 stars. I would do business again with 10Gtek in the future, and recommend them. ________________________________________________ Previous post from February 4, 2020: (***NOTE: This is the outdated report that does not contain all the information and does not reflect current perspectives. It is only retained for historical purposes.) I have two LSI MetaRAID 9361-8i cards in a VMware host, each which are linked to an Intel 36x expander card. I have two sets of cables (four cables in all) in order to connect those expander cards to an external chassis. I first purchased a set of cables from another manufacturer that were twice the cost of these ones. When I came across these cables by 10Gtek and saw the much lower price, and the high user ratings, I thought these would be a great purchase for the second expander card. Both sets of cables have been in operation for a couple months now. Verdict: These less expensive cables have dropped connections numerous times, causing arrays to have to be rebuilt. Thankfully we haven't lost any data yet. Any time these cheaper cables are even bumped or moved a few inches in the middle portion of the cable (without touching the connection points), they almost always lose disks in the array, causing degraded arrays, and greater risk to losing data. By contrast, that has never once happened with the more expensive cables from the other manufacturer: even when moved, those expensive cables consistently maintain their connections to the drives.

I picked this up to test if I had a failing cable, card, or controller in a DAS unit. The cable itself came in a reusable package and looked to be good quality, albeit slightly thinner than the EMC cable it was replacing for testing. After installing it, everything worked as expected, no issue, no increase in errors or anything to the sort. In the end my problem turned out to be a controller, but this cable is still the one I'm using and I've relegated the EMC cable to the back shelf as this one is much easier to cable manage, insert, and remove.
